We wish to inform you that the Council of the Historical Society of Nigeria at its meeting during the 47th/48th Congress at the Imo State University, Owerri, from 10-13 October 2004, fixed the 3rd Week of October 2005 (i.e. 16-21 October 2005) for the Golden Jubilee Congress of our Society at the University of Ibadan.
The theme for the Golden Jubilee Conference is “HISTORICAL SOCIETY OF NIGERIA AT 50; REFLECTIONS ON THE DISCIPLINE OF HISTORY” The Sub-themes are as follows:
- The State of Historical Discipline in Nigeria
- New Frontiers in Nigerian History
- Nigerian Historians and Nigerian History
- Re-invigorating the Historical Society of Nigeria
- Re-awakening Historical Awareness and Scholarship in Nigeria
- History, Historians and the Crisis of relevance in Nigeria
- History teaching in Nigerian schools and colleges
- Historical Scholarship in Nigerian tertiary institutions: Challenges and Prospects
- Promotion of Nigerian History outside Nigeria
- History and National Development
- History and Social Change in Nigeria
- History and the Social Sciences
- History Departments: What name, What nomenclature?
Interested participants at this conference are required to submit abstracts of not more than 200 words on any of the sub-themes. Abstracts/Papers may be submitted by e-mail to either the Chairman or Secretary of the Local Organizing Committee.
